There's a certain kind of house that makes you pause before you even reach the door; 260 St. Leonards Avenue is that kind of place. Tucked away in Lawrence Park, this Georgian-inspired home, built in 2003, blends classic architecture with a touch of modern style across 6,000 square feet and three levels. Inside, the atmosphere is welcoming and bright, with sunlight pouring through the foyer and highlighting custom millwork. There's a private office for focused work, and the living room, anchored by a wood-burning fireplace, is made for cozy evenings. The dining room features stained glass and custom wainscotting, elevating even the simplest meal. At the heart of the home is the kitchen: a marble-topped island, custom cabinetry, and high-end appliances. Sunlight fills the breakfast nook, while the family room, complete with a gas fireplace and a wall of windows blends seamlessly with the outdoors. French doors lead to a deck perfect for barbecues, with a stone patio and gas fireplace surrounded by gardens for total privacy. This backyard is made for gatherings, alfresco dinners, and unforgettable summer nights. Practical spaces get equal attention: a designer powder room, main-floor laundry with built-in storage, and a bar area for entertaining. Upstairs, the primary suite is a true retreat with vaulted ceilings, a custom dressing room, and a spa-like ensuite featuring a waterfall shower and dual marble vanities. Three additional bedrooms are sunlit and spacious, each with custom closets. The lower level is designed for fun; think recreation room with fireplace, gym, guest/nanny suite with ensuite bath, flex space, access to the garage, and a climate-controlled wine cellar. The location is unbeatable: tree-lined St. Leonards Avenue offers easy access to trails, top private schools, and the Granite Club.
